What is fabric printing?

Fabric printing is the process of applying color, patterns, or designs onto textile fabrics using various techniques, such as screen printing, digital printing, or block printing. This process allows for the creation of unique and customized designs on materials used in fashion, home décor, and other industries. Depending on the method, fabric printing can be done manually or with specialized machinery, and it often involves the use of dyes, pigments, and fixatives to ensure the prints are durable and vibrant.

What are some common challenges faced in a fabric printing role, and how can they be overcome?

In a fabric printing role, common challenges include ensuring color consistency across large batches, preventing misalignment or smudging of prints, and maintaining the quality of both the fabric and the print. These issues can be managed by performing regular equipment calibration, closely monitoring the printing process, and conducting quality checks at each stage. Effective communication with designers and production teams also helps ensure that design intentions are met and potential problems are addressed early.

What is the difference between Fabric Printing vs Fabric Dyeing?

AspectFabric PrintingFabric Dyeing
ProcessApplying patterns or images onto fabric surface using inks or dyesColoring fabric uniformly or in specific sections by immersing or applying dyes
Tools & TechniquesScreen printing, digital printing, block printingImmersion dyeing, tie-dye, batik
Work EnvironmentDesign studios, textile factoriesTextile dye houses, manufacturing plants
CredentialsDesign skills, knowledge of printing techniquesKnowledge of dye chemistry, safety certifications

Fabric printing and fabric dyeing are both essential textile processes but serve different purposes. Printing adds decorative patterns to fabric surfaces, while dyeing colors the entire fabric or sections uniformly.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right process for textile design and production.

JOB TITLE: Fabric Line Certified Operator
REPORTS TO: Fabric Team Leader
CATEGORY: Operator III
Day or night shift available. 12-hour days, flexible schedule - full-time with exceptional benefits!
SUMMARY:
With little supervision, sets up, operates and performs complex maintenance on a variety of specialized production and non-production equipment. May sort, load, unload, check and inspect. Instructs and directs one or more Assistants. Keep necessary records, reports reject and failure patterns. Works to sketches, diagrams, and drawings, written and verbal instructions. Acts to maintain the integrity of processes and final product quality.
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
  • Lead by example (safety, conduct, policy, and work ethic)
  • Maintain the integrity of processes and products with focus on safety, quality, and production
  • The ability to read and interpret assembly prints and basic blueprints
  • Responds appropriately to system, process or material problems
  • Performs required inventory functions (e.g. inquiries, updates, transactions, certs)
  • Train and mentor new associates in process and line operation
  • Performs Daily Team Maintenance activities
  • Monitors and maintains dynamic air flow/filter system
  • Develop Visual Work Instructions
  • Develop perform required task for product changeover to Standard Work Instructions
  • Perform complex fiber blending/color corrections
  • Monitors and maintains department 5-S standards
  • Performs TPM activities
  • The ability to read and interpret complex HMI operation system
  • Follow written Work Order instructions using proper materials
  • Follow written SOC (Standard Operating Condition) maintaining quality and machine throughput
  • Follow written SOP (Standard Operating Procedure) using correct packaging materials and tools
  • Performs required tasks for product changeover and startup
  • Previous experience in the operation of high-volume manufacturing equipment and the use of common hand tools
  • Use of efficient time management skills to increase machine uptime
  • Able to prioritize internal and external job functions to minimize downtime
  • Advanced knowledge in Fabric processes and troubleshooting.
  • Understands all job hazards, demonstrates safe behaviors
  • Continuous Skills Development Program
  • Data entry (E1) for material use, finish good, time entries (run time and down time)
  • Perform required quality assurance testing and data entry
  • Able to pass written and demonstrative test
  • Performs other duties as assigned

PHYSICAL DEMANDS:
  • Occasional lifting
  • Frequent standing/walking

REQUIRED TRAINING:
  • Basic hazardous communication
  • PPE
  • Emergency fire plan
  • On-the-job safety review
